Came back to watch again. I got the bandera and it's working great. Will be adding a Lavalock ATC temp controller / stoker. One really good upgrade is to add a charcoal basket. There's a few good DIY vids on YT for no-weld versions you can make for about $20. I weld so I made a really sturdy welded one either way... It is a goid upgrade to have your coals contained. Just place the basket on top of the coal grate it came with. Takes much less fuel to maintain a consistent cook temp.

@DIY_Semi-Pro6 жыл бұрын
Well, the verdict is still out on the DigiQ DX2. I may have put it in the wrong place as it's blowing air away from the smokebox inlet directly above it. I'm going to make contact with the Mfr. and inquire about moving it before I drill any more holes. The good thing is, I'll make to circle metal plugs drilled out so I can put a bolt through it and "shouldn't" lose any smoke...plus, it's under the smokebox, so don't think anyone but me will know. I do like the DigiQ DX2 for its functionality so far. Easy temperature setup, and the temp display (Pit & Food) are great to have...even though I did the boiling water test on the supplied thermostat dial (which was close by 2 degrees), I notice a difference between the DigiQ up above 225. The DigiQ will read 270 for instance, and the dial temp gauge reads like 300 plus. I had 2 pieces of brisket this past weekend with the DigiQ and another digital device and both temp probes read close to one another. So, I think accuracy is on par for now...I just have to determine the best location for the blower :/
